floating voter

floating voter

n
(Government, Politics & Diplomacy) a person who does not vote consistently for any single political party

Noun1.floating voter - a voter who has no allegiance to any political party and whose unpredictable decisions can swing the outcome of an election one way or the other
elector, voter - a citizen who has a legal right to vote
